The most affordable sinks today are stainless-steel and also pushed steel. The lower cost stainless and the pressed steel are likewise referred to as "apartment or condo" quality. They call them this due to the fact that home proprietors, seeking the cheapest prices have a tendency to utilize these items. If you get on a budget and also your family are not hefty users of the kitchen area sink, these might be an attractive option to a lot more costly materials. Understand though that the pressed steel sink usually has a repainted surface area that scrapes and chips conveniently. These sinks will certainly have a tendency to look old as well as obsolete rapidly due to the coating used. The stainless additionally scratches quickly but if taken care of appropriately, it will remain to look appropriate. Less costly stainless-steel sinks have a tendency to be constructed from thinner material which implies that water being faced them and also the garbage disposal will seem a great deal louder on these more economical versions. These sinks come in rimless and top mounted models.

A certain upgrade to these products is the cast iron kitchen area sink. These sinks are made from casted metal them finished with a porcelain material giving them a deep and also beautiful radiance. The finish is long wearing as well as with a little occasional shaving, can look terrific for several years. They can be found in a selection of colors and can be ordered in undercounter installing or leading installing designs. These cooking area sinks nonetheless are heavy and much more difficult to mount so unless you are incredibly convenient as well as have experience with these sinks, you will certainly need a professional for installment.

Another sink material that appears to be getting in popularity is the strong surface area kind material These are a sturdy material developed right into a kitchen area sink and also tend to be more of a matte finish. This type of sink product goes particularly well with more all-natural coatings in your kitchen area. Although not as prominent as cast-iron, these composite cooking area sinks are rapidly gaining a solid following.

Select Your Kitchen Wash Basin Design Based on Its Configuration


The kitchen sink has ceased to be a single-basin entity — today, it comes in a variety of configurations, each suited to a different multitasking style. Single-basin sinks are most common because they allow you to wash plenty of large-sized utensils at once. This type of kitchen sink design suits nearly any kind of kitchen.



The kitchen double sink design sink has two basins and allows you to prep for cooking and wash up in the same space. A similar look can be achieved with offset kitchen sink designs where one basin is slightly smaller than the other. These are better for smaller kitchens, where countertop space may be scarce.



Similarly, the half-and-half kitchen wash basin design with two equal-sized basins can accommodate a lot more utensils and free up space. This is ideal for homes that tend to entertain more or simply use a lot more dishes.


Pick Out Your Preferred Shape for the Kitchen Basin Design


You might not be installing a fancy marble sink, but the shape of your kitchen basin design still matters. When deciding on how to choose a sink for the kitchen, many homeowners find that sinks with rounded edges are easier to clean. This is because dirt and food don’t get stuck in rounded corners unlike corners with defined edges.



A modern kitchen sink design can hit two birds with one stone by displaying crisp top edges and rounded bottom corners. Here, you get the benefit of a neat design along with functional utility as well. A modern kitchen sink design, combined with an attached drainboard, is the ideal choice for homes of any kind. However, ensure you have enough countertop space to fit it!


Zone In on the Right Material


Stainless steel is everyone’s go-to when it comes to choosing a sink. It’s durable, long-lasting and virtually indestructible. If you have hard water coming out of your taps, you’ll likely see water stains forming but that won’t affect the use of the sink much.



Porcelain sinks sit better in vintage-style kitchens or those channelling a farmhouse aesthetic. Beware of chipping though! Stone and granite are also aesthetically pleasing choices but they can prove to be expensive and high maintenance in the long run.


Kitchen Sink Accessories Can Make or Break the Utility of Your Sink


When it comes to kitchen sink accessories, taps are probably the first thing that comes to mind. Though it may seem like an easy enough decision style-wise, they can make or break your experience. This is because the placement and design of your kitchen sink accessories can hinder the functionality of the space.



Even if you go for the classic two-knob tap, consider installing an extendable spray or shower arm — this will help clean out far corners of the sink and fill large pots easily.
